Search Cheap Hotels in Petrovac

Start date: Check-in selected.
To Date
End date: Check-out
  • Change your mind

    Book hotels with free cancellation
  • Treat yourself

    Sign in to save 10% or more on thousands of hotels
  • Be picky

    Search almost a million properties worldwide

Check availability on Petrovac Cheap Hotels

Next weekend
In two weeks

Our top choices for Petrovac cheap hotels

Mahakala Center

Mahakala Center
3.0 star property
Petrovac
10.0 out of 10, Exceptional, (1)
"Amazing tranquil stay "
United Kingdom
Madje
The price is ฿953
฿1,169 total
includes taxes & fees
13 Jan - 14 Jan 2026
Mahakala Center

Beachfront Apartments Oaza

Beachfront Apartments Oaza
3.0 star property
Petrovac
The price is ฿915
฿1,125 total
includes taxes & fees
17 Jan - 18 Jan 2026
Beachfront Apartments Oaza

Monte Casa Spa & Wellness

Monte Casa Spa & Wellness
4.5 star property
Petrovac
8.6 out of 10, Excellent, (41)
"Amazing !!"
United Kingdom
Yaw Agyei
The price is ฿2,909
฿3,419 total
includes taxes & fees
28 Dec - 29 Dec
Monte Casa Spa & Wellness

Beachfront Apartments Oaza 2

Beachfront Apartments Oaza 2
3.0 star property
Petrovac
The price is ฿1,372
฿1,651 total
includes taxes & fees
28 Dec - 29 Dec
Beachfront Apartments Oaza 2

Guest House Medin

Guest House Medin
3.0 star property
Petrovac
10.0 out of 10, Exceptional, (1)
Guest House Medin

St. George Apartments and Villa with pool

St. George Apartments and Villa with pool
4.0 star property
Petrovac
8.4 out of 10, Very good, (12)
"Would definitely recommend staying at St George’s apartments. We arrived late on our first night and had nowhere to go for dinner, however, the host was kind enough to bring us some food to cook"
United Kingdom
Jamie
St. George Apartments and Villa with pool

Hotel Ami Budva Petrovac

Hotel Ami Budva Petrovac
5.0 star property
Petrovac
9.2 out of 10, Wonderful, (52)
"Our sea view room was beautiful. We'll definitely be staying here again <3."
United Kingdom
Niyathi
Hotel Ami Budva Petrovac

Hotel Danica

Hotel Danica
3.0 star property
Petrovac
8.2 out of 10, Very good, (62)
"Flott opphold her. Rommet var stort, med svær balkong. Litt slitt. Flott beliggenhet, veldig hyggelig og behjelpelig personale. Grei frokost. "
Norway
Tiril
The price is ฿2,794
฿3,286 total
includes taxes & fees
28 Dec - 29 Dec
Hotel Danica

Casa Oliva Villas

Casa Oliva Villas
3.5 star property
Petrovac
The price is ฿2,063
฿2,446 total
includes taxes & fees
28 Dec - 29 Dec
Casa Oliva Villas

Apartments Azimut Rezevici

Apartments Azimut Rezevici
3.0 star property
Petrovac
The price is ฿2,722
฿5,583 total
includes taxes & fees
3 Jan - 4 Jan 2026
Apartments Azimut Rezevici
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.

Top Petrovac Hotel Reviews

Frequently asked questions

What is Petrovac like for travellers on a budget?
Explore cheap places to stay in Petrovac on Expedia.com and plan a trip that matches your budget. You can look through a wide range of accommodation choices with Member Prices to find great deals and earn rewards. Guided by our site's handy page filters, you can search by price per night, or by favourite amenities like free breakfast and a swimming pool. If you're hoping for reasonable options around local sights, such as Perazica Do Beach or Buljarica Beach, try out the location filters to narrow down your search. While you browse, use the heart button to keep track of your favourites so that you can return to them easily when you're ready to book. Need a flight or a car for your trip? Take a look at the Bundle and Save holiday packages and discover huge discounts by arranging transport at the same time.
What's the best budget-friendly hotel in Petrovac?
Based on our traveller reviews, Petrovac Serenity Stay Near the Beach is a top choice for a less expensive stay.
When is the best time for a budget trip to Petrovac?
Weather is probably a major factor when you plan your trip to Petrovac, but bear in mind that cheaper options are usually available when the weather isn't as good. The hottest months are usually August and July, with an average temperature of 23°C, while the coldest months are January and February, with an average of 8°C. The rainiest months in Petrovac are November, December, January and March, with each month seeing an average of 307 mm of rainfall.
What is there to see and do in Petrovac?
You don't need to spend a fortune to get to know Petrovac. You can budget for the top local attractions on your list, and then plan some activities that are easy on the wallet. Explore and snap photos of landmarks like Roman mosaics, or enjoy the outdoors at Perazica Do Beach and Buljarica Beach.
How can I get to Petrovac and get around on a budget?
Scoping out the transportation options in Petrovac is a smart way to keep your trip affordable. The most convenient airport is 18.1 mi (29.2 km) from the centre in Tivat (TIV). However, if that doesn't suit your budget, you can look into flights to Podgorica (TGD), which is 19.2 mi (30.8 km) away. Petrovac may not have many public transport choices so a rental car could be a reasonable alternative to explore more of the area.